What to Look for in an Automatic Vacuum Cleaner: Key Features and Considerations

Choosing the ideal automatic vacuum includes thinking about numerous aspects to guarantee it successfully meets your cleaning needs and incorporates seamlessly into your way of life. Here are some important aspects to assess before buying:

  • Navigation System: A robot vacuum's navigation system is its brain, dictating how efficiently and successfully it cleans your floorings. Different types of navigation exist:

    • Random/Bounce Navigation: Older and frequently affordable designs utilize this system. They move randomly, bouncing off obstacles till the battery is low. While they eventually cover the location, their cleaning patterns are less efficient and can miss areas.
    • Systematic Navigation (Row-by-Row): These vacuums clean in straight lines, methodically covering a location. They are more effective than random navigation and provide better protection.
    • L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) Navigation: Utilizing lasers, LiDAR develops comprehensive maps of your home. This enables for extremely efficient and systematic cleaning, smart course planning, and features like room-specific cleaning and virtual limits.
    • Camera-Based S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ping) Navigation: These vacuums utilize cams to aesthetically map their environments. They use comparable smart features to LiDAR, however their efficiency can be affected by lighting conditions.
  • Suction Power: The strength of a robot vacuum's suction determines its ability to get dirt, dust, debris, and pet hair from various floor types. Greater suction power is usually much better, specifically for carpets and homes with animals. Search for specifications like Pascal (Pa) rating to compare suction levels between designs.

  • Battery Life and Coverage Area: Battery life determines how long a robot vacuum can operate on a single charge. Think about the size of your home and choose a design with enough battery life to cover your cleaning location. Some advanced designs feature automatic charging and resume, returning to the charging dock when low and after that resuming cleaning where they left off.

  • Functions and Functionality: Beyond fundamental vacuuming, many robot vacuums provide extra features that improve their convenience and cleaning capabilities:

    • Mopping Functionality: Some hybrid designs integrate vacuuming and mopping, offering a 2-in-1 cleaning service. These might consist of different water tanks and mopping pads.
    • Self-Emptying Dustbins: Premium designs come with self-emptying bases. The robot vacuum automatically clears its dustbin into a bigger bin in the base, reducing the frequency of manual emptying.
    • App Control and Smart Home Integration: Wi-Fi connection allows control by means of smartphone apps. Functions might consist of scheduling cleansings, changing suction levels, viewing cleaning maps, setting virtual borders, and integrating with voice assistants like Alexa or Google Assistant.
    • Floor Type Detection: Smart vacuums can find various floor types (hardwood, carpet, rugs) and change suction power automatically for optimum cleaning.
    • Obstacle Avoidance and Object Recognition: Advanced sensors and AI algorithms help robot vacuums browse around furniture, pet bowls, and even determine and avoid smaller things like shoes or cables, preventing them from getting stuck or dragging items around.
  • Maintenance and Durability: Consider the ease of upkeep, such as emptying the dustbin, cleaning brushes, and replacing filters. Look for models with easily available parts and offered replacement parts. Read evaluations concerning the vacuum's resilience and reliability.

  • Price and Value: Robot vacuums vary in cost from affordable to premium. Identify your budget plan and balance functions and efficiency with expense. Consider the long-term worth of a robot vacuum in terms of time conserved and benefit.

Top Automatic Vacuum Cleaners: Leading Models in the Market

With a wide range of options offered, identifying the really "best" automatic vacuum is subjective and depends upon individual needs and top priorities. However, a number of designs regularly rank high in reviews and use exceptional performance and functions. Here are a couple of noteworthy examples:

  • iRobot Roomba j7+: Renowned for its smart navigation and item recognition, the Roomba j7+ is a leading competitor. Its PrecisionVision Navigation determines obstacles and learns to prevent them, reducing interruptions. The "+" denotes the Clean Base automatic dirt disposal, making maintenance a lot more hands-off. It's app-controlled, incorporates with smart homes, and uses excellent cleaning performance, especially for pet hair.

    • Pros: Exceptional obstacle avoidance, self-emptying base, smart mapping and features, strong cleaning performance.
    • Cons: Higher rate point, dust bags for the Clean Base need replacing.
    • Best for: Homes with pets and mess, users focusing on smart functions and benefit.
  • Eufy RoboVac X8 Hybrid: Offering a balance of efficiency and value, the Eufy RoboVac X8 Hybrid delivers strong suction with its twin-turbine system. It features iPath Laser Navigation for efficient mapping and navigation, and includes a mopping function for hard floorings. App control, Robot Hoover virtual boundaries, and zone cleaning add to its flexibility.

    • Pros: Powerful suction, LiDAR navigation at a competitive cost, mopping feature, app control.
    • Cons: Dustbin requires manual emptying, mopping is standard compared to dedicated mopping robots.
    • Best for: Users looking for effective cleaning and smart navigation without the premium price, those with combined floor types.
  • Shark IQ Robot Self-Empty XL R101AE: The Shark IQ robot cleaner line uses strong efficiency at a more accessible cost point, especially the Self-Empty XL model. It includes row-by-row cleaning, self-emptying base, and app control with scheduling and zone cleaning. It navigates successfully and offers strong suction for everyday cleaning.

    • Pros: Self-emptying dustbin, excellent cleaning performance for the cost, row-by-row navigation, app control.
    • Cons: Navigation not as advanced as LiDAR or camera-based systems, can deal with complicated layouts.
    • Best for: Users trying to find a self-emptying robot vacuum at a mid-range price, efficient for basic home cleaning.
  • Roborock S7 MaxV Ultra: Representing the high-end of robot vacuum technology, the Roborock S7 MaxV Ultra is a powerhouse of cleaning and automation. It boasts LiDAR navigation, reactive challenge avoidance, powerful suction, and a comprehensive docking station that not just self-empties however likewise cleans and dries the mop pad and refills the water tank.

    • Pros: Ultimate automation with self-emptying, mop washing, and water refilling, advanced obstacle avoidance, LiDAR navigation, effective suction, sonic mopping.
    • Cons: Very high rate, complex setup might be frightening for some users.
    • Best for: Tech lovers and users looking for the most automatic and feature-rich cleaning experience, those with big homes and requiring cleaning requirements.

Note: This is not an extensive list, and new designs are continuously being released. It is always suggested to research study present reviews and compare requirements based upon your particular needs and budget plan.

Tips for Maximizing Your Robot Vacuum's Performance

To guarantee your automatic vacuum cleaner runs effectively and lasts longer, follow these simple ideas:

  • Regular Maintenance: Empty the dustbin frequently, clean brushes and rollers of hair and debris, and change filters as suggested by the producer to keep ideal suction and efficiency.
  • Prepare the Floor: Before each cleaning cycle, remove mess like cables, small toys, and loose items that could obstruct the robot vacuum or get tangled in its brushes.
  • Utilize Virtual Boundaries and No-Go Zones: Use virtual borders or physical limit strips (if supported) to prevent the robot vacuum from entering locations you don't desire cleaned up or getting stuck in problematic spots.
  • Try out Scheduling: Optimize your cleaning schedule based on your way of life and home traffic patterns. Think about scheduling cleanings when you run out your house to reduce disruption.
  • Keep Software Updated: For smart robot vacuums, guarantee you keep the firmware and app upgraded to gain from the most current functions, enhancements, and bug fixes.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s) about Automatic Vacuum Cleaners

  • How typically should I run my robot vacuum? For optimum tidiness, running your robot vacuum day-to-day or every other day is recommended, especially in families with animals or high foot traffic.
  • Can robot vacuums deal with pet hair? Yes, lots of robot vacuums are particularly created for pet hair with features like tangle-free brushes and strong suction. Designs specifically marketed for pet owners often perform best.
  • Do robot vacuums deal with carpets? Yes, most robot vacuums deal with carpets and tough floors. The effectiveness on carpets can vary depending on the suction power and brush type. Higher-end models with stronger suction and specialized brushes carry out better on carpets.
  • How long do robot vacuums last? The life-span of a robot vacuum can vary depending upon the brand, model, usage, and upkeep. Generally, you can expect a well-maintained robot vacuum to last for 3-5 years, or perhaps longer.
  • Are robot vacuums worth the money? For many individuals, the benefit, time savings, and consistent cleaning used by robot vacuums make them a rewarding financial investment. Consider your way of life, cleaning needs, and budget plan to determine if a robot vacuum is the ideal option for you.
